There were actually times in Legion/BFA where using scatter into trap was useful since it could bypass adaptation (sub 5 second CC’s so they had to eat it).
Also scatter is useful against Ele teams. You can scatter the Ele right as a healer gets stunned to stop him from grounding, or scatter Spriests to stop mass dispel etc.

Hunter’s problem is that absolutely nothing they do is consistent or reliable. Traps aren’t reliable unless someone spends resources to set them up. Hunters burst isn’t reliable because it requires someone to stand in the Kyrian bubble and not see the Explosive Shot ticking down on them. Hunter can’t cover their own burst window with their own CC. Their sustained damage requires the target to not LoS a 2.5 second hard cast.
Adding more damage, or another random peel option, isn’t going to fix Hunter’s complete unreliability on anything. They require more resources to make work then Mage, and their payout is lower then Mage
